Panama


Panama is a new country in my collection, thanks to Anyi. Panama is the southmost country of Central America, covering the area of app. 75 000 square kilometres. The populations is about 3.6 million. The capital and largest city is Panama City, which can be seen above. 
Panama was inhabited by several indigenous tribes prior to settlement by the Spanish in the 16th century. It broke away from Spain in 1821 and joined a union of Nueva GranadaEcuador, and Venezuela named the Republic of Gran Colombia.  With the backing of the United States, Panama seceded from Colombia in 1903, allowing the Panama Canal to be built by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ers between 1904 and 1914. In 1977, an agreement was signed for the total transfer of the Canal from the United States to Panama by the end of the 20th century, which culminated on 31 December 1999.
